Will This Setup Work?????
Hello,
I'm looking to dual boot Snow leopard and windows 7 with an i7. I've done some research and this is what i came up with. anything that's not compatible would be greatful to be pointed out. Also if you know a way to make setup cheaper with out compromising to much power please tell me ( as its about $1000 right now). Case Antec Twelve Hundred Tower Mother Board Gigabyte GA-P55M-UD2 Graphics Card EVGA 896-P3-1260-RX Memory CORSAIR XMS3 6GB (3 x 2GB) TR3X6G1600C8 G CPU Intel Core i7-860 2.8GHz Power Supply Sunbeam PSU-H680-REV-US-BL 680W Optic Drive LG 22X DVD Burner GH22NS40 Hard Drives (X2) Western Digital Caviar Green WD10EARS 1TB I plan to use it to run Logic Pro, final cut studios, and 3d software like MAYA 2011. You need X58 mobo for i7 920 (LGA 1366), you chose P55, which is for LGA 1156 processors (like i7 860 or i5 750). So you have to change either motherboard or processor to get it working.
The rest seems to be OK. |

Also Ive heard Hackintosh comps have keyboard and mouse problems. Anyone know if i have to buy a specific keyboard? |
#4
|
|||
|
|||
There are problems with PS/2 devices, so buy any USB keyboard and mouse. I'm using one of Logitech's usb wireless keyboards and a no-name USB mouse and they both work fine with OS X.
Or you can buy Apple's wireless keyboard and mighty/magic mouse and use them with almost any USB Bluetooth dongle. |
